Step by Step Home Building Guide

 

Building a home is often described as a time of mixed emotion, and whether the decision stems from a desire for a better home, a nicer location, or a growing family, it can be a time of great excitement and nervous anticipation. So, to achieve a great outcome it’s important to follow a few key steps, and in today’s blog we’re going to explore them a bit further with the Director of Highfields Builder Pty Ltd Scott Hartshorn

 

According to Scott building a new home is a structured process and doesn’t just fall into place with one or two meetings between the customer and the builder. It’s very important the homeowner is able to engage and communicate effortlessly with the builder and their team, to understand the many steps in bringing their dream to reality. That’s why selecting the right builder is so important to a successful outcome.

 

 

  1. Right from the first conversation it’s important to speak with the builder and get a good understanding of the home building process, and the steps they will take to complete a quality project. Be wary of slick performers and salespeople that disappear as soon as you sign a contract, leaving you bewildered at who to deal with at each critical step. At Highfields Builder you remain engaged with Scott and Bonni from the first phone call to the handover!
  2. Ask about the construction planning process, the builders communication strategy (we’re sure you want to be kept informed every step of the way!), and the costs involved in building a home.
     
  3. At this point it’s important to bring finance into the conversation. If a customer needs finance to complete the project then it’s important to know borrowing capacity based on their financial position, available deposit, and other factors before starting to plan the style and size of the home. There is no use planning to build a home costing $350,000 when borrowing capacity is only $300,000! Scott Hartshorn recommends speaking with a finance professional as early as possible to explore borrowing capacity and the available finance options.
     
  4. Government Incentives – First Home Buyers may be eligible for a range of incentives and fee discounts when purchasing vacant land and constructing a home. (Eligibility criteria applies.) Exploring these incentives is highly recommended and may save thousands!
     
  5. At the time of making contact with a builder the homeowner may have already purchased vacant land or be planning to do so. Highfields Builder construct homes on customers land and also offer a range of land options to purchase.
     
  6. After the initial meetings the builder will prepare a formal quotation outlining in broad terms the costs to complete the building project from all the information gathered. After accepting the quotation, the builder will prepare a contract that includes plans, specifications, inclusions, exclusions, timeframes and other important information relating to the project.
